>>>>>> Hi Adinah, I have a plug-in Toyota and I plan to bring it directly to
>>>>>> the dealership because I don't want to compromise the warranty, and because
>>>>>> my normal mechanic cannot work on it due to the battery and how advanced
>>>>>> the computer technology is. Like David said, I think the dealership is
>>>>>> going to be the best place most of the time. I hope that some of the
>>>>>> smaller mechanics can find a way to get into the business of working on
>>>>>> these; hopefully that will happen over time. I just don't personally know
>>>>>> of any that are doing it now.
